% 18.07.2018 Learned counsel for the parties state in unison that classes are being held regularly in the respondent No.1/Jawaharlal Nehru University with effect from mid May, 2018 itself.
Learned counsel for respondent No.1/University assures this Court that respondent No.1/University will take all steps to ensure that classes are held regularly and all the students, who wish to attend classes, will be permitted to attend the same, without any hindrance or disturbance. Learned counsel for respondent No.1 further assures the Court that the petitioner's prayer for grant of relaxation on the requirement of attendance, will be considered sympathetically by the respondent No.1/University as per its rules and regulations.
In view of the aforesaid assurance given by learned counsel for respondent No.1, learned counsel for the petitioner does not wish to press the present petition.
W.P.(C) 3161/2018
The petition is disposed of as not pressed.
